Designed by ICRAVE, this petit brasserie exudes the old world charm of a Parisian cafe. The menu, created by Chefs Riad Nasr and Lee Hanson, features the flavors and textures of simple French country cooking. Starters range from the classic onion soup gratinee to frisee aux lardons to avocado and shrimp salad to a duck and pistachio terrine. Salads and sandwiches are designed with the traveler in mind, and include Salade Nicoise, Croque Monsieur or Madame, Pan Bagnet, Grilled Chicken Paillard and a steak sandwich as well as a hamburger. The entrees are terrific—from a seared salmon with mustard crust and green lentils to moules frites aux Pernod to sauteed prawns Provençal as well as couscous with grilled vegetables and a steak frites. The stunning plats du jour range from braised short ribs to Coquilles St.-Jacques, Sole Meuniere and Trout Almondine. And—c'est incroyable!—also over a dozen breakfast dishes that span from Eggs Benedict to brioche french toast.

Of all the Terminal 5 restaurants, this one clearly has the most old-world charm. And also the fewest number of seats!
